A roof inspection is the first step whenever you're worried about storm damage, planning to sell a house, or trying to get an insurance claim approved. A contractor who specializes in this area climbs the roof (or runs a drone), photographs the shingles, flashing, and decking, and writes up a damage report that documents things like wind-lifted shingles, hail bruising, cracked pipe boots, or granule loss. That report is what actually matters to an insurance adjuster: a vague "looks fine" walkaround doesn't hold up, but a dated, photo-backed report with measurements does.

In Columbus, this work spans a wide range of storm seasons, from spring hail to summer wind events, so timing an inspection soon after a storm (and before your insurer's claim window closes) matters. What to look for before you hire

  • Local claims experience: a contractor who has worked with adjusters in Franklin County before knows how claims here typically get evaluated and what documentation adjusters expect.
  • Written, photo-based reports: ask to see a sample before you commit. A report with dated photos and specific damage locations carries far more weight than a verbal opinion.
  • No cost until scope is confirmed: most reputable inspectors offer a free or low-cost initial look, then charge only if you move forward with repair work.
  • Manufacturer and licensing credentials: these matter for warranty coverage on any repair work that follows the claim.
  • Clear separation between inspection and repair: be cautious of anyone pressuring you to sign a repair contract before the insurance decision is even made.

Common questions about roof inspection & insurance claims

How much does a roof inspection cost in Columbus?
Many contractors offer a free inspection, especially when it's tied to a possible insurance claim or a repair estimate. Independent or pre-purchase inspections not connected to a repair job sometimes carry a fee, roughly in the $100-$300 range, though it varies by company and roof size.
How often should a roof be inspected?
A general rule is once a year, plus an extra check after any major hail or wind storm. Roofs older than 15-20 years or with known trouble spots (like flashing around chimneys or skylights) often benefit from more frequent looks.
What should I expect during an insurance claim inspection?
The contractor documents damage with photos and measurements, identifies whether it's storm-related versus normal wear, and often meets the insurance adjuster on-site to walk through findings together. You should get a written report you can submit with your claim, and a realistic sense of whether the damage likely meets your policy's threshold.
How can I judge whether a roofing contractor does quality inspection work?
Ask for a sample report to see how detailed and specific it is, confirm they carry proper licensing and insurance, and check whether they have a track record working with adjusters locally. A contractor who explains what they found and why, rather than just pushing for a full replacement, is usually a better sign.
